The Ultimate Food Truck Buyer's Checklist
Embarking on the endeavor of food truck ownership? Avoid rushing into it! This list provides a detailed buyer's checklist to ensure you obtain the perfect mobile kitchen. First, evaluate your menu - this more info dictates the necessary gear and truck capacity. Next, obtain funding – investigate loans, subsidies, and private savings. Subsequently, the truck itself! Look for a reliable vendor and inspect the unit meticulously. Here's a snapshot of key areas:
Truck Condition: Inspect the motor, foot brakes, wiring, and water system.
Equipment: Ensure all food preparation equipment is functional and meets health code standards.
Permits & Licenses: Determine the essential permits and licenses for your location.
Insurance: Secure adequate business insurance coverage.
Budget: Formulate a realistic budget covering each possible outlays.
In conclusion, due diligence is positively critical for a successful food truck enterprise.

Locating Used Food Trucks for Sale: Opportunities & Factors
The allure of owning a catering truck is significant, but acquiring a fresh one can be pricey. That's why lots of aspiring business owners are considering used catering trucks available sale. Uncovering a excellent deal requires careful research and a grounded understanding of the likely issues.
Review the vehicle's mechanical state : Powerplant operation , gearbox , and stopping system are essential.
Determine appliances : Verify ovens, deep fryers , and refrigeration units functionality .
Consider past management : Question about the unit's history and some repairs .
Set a spending limit including expected upkeep fees.
Don't forget that a cheaper price can often indicate potential problems . Qualified assessments are highly recommended before making any purchase .
